How they compare

Lithuania currently reports 47,651 against 36,162 in Finland, a difference of 11,489.

That makes Lithuania's figure about 1.3 times Finland's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 14 shared years of data; in 2003 it was Finland ahead.

Finland ranks 17th and Lithuania ranks 14th of 32 countries.

Lithuania has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
